site stats

Binary tree using preorder and inorder

WebThe binary tree could be constructed as below. A given pre-order traversal sequence is used to find the root node of the binary tree to be constructed. The root node is then … WebJul 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Construct Binary Tree from Inorder and Preorder traversal

WebCreate Binary Search TreeTraversal Of Inorder Rules : Left - Data - RightTraversal Of Preorder Rules : Data -Left - Right WebInorder/Preorder Traversals, Binary Tree/Node Class - GitHub - adv3k/Binary-Tree-Implementation: Inorder/Preorder Traversals, Binary Tree/Node Class css insurance halifax https://thecircuit-collective.com

Drawing Binary Tree from inorder and preorder - Stack …

Web9 hours ago · I'm having some trouble with Binary Trees in java. The assignment wants me to build a binary tree and then create functions to return the next node in preorder, postorder, and inorder. ... The assignment wants me to build a binary tree and then create functions to return the next node in preorder, postorder, and inorder. So here is my … WebConstruct a binary tree from inorder and level order sequence Write an efficient algorithm to construct a binary tree from the given inorder and level order sequence. For example, Input: Inorder Traversal : { 4, 2, 5, 1, 6, 3, 7 } level order traversal : { 1, 2, 3, 4, 5, 6, 7 } Output: Below binary tree Practice this problem Webdepth first traversals. Breadth first traversals. Depth first traversals of Binary tree: Inorder traversal. Preorder traversal. Postorder traversal. In this article we will learn three Depth first traversals namely inorder, preorder … css insurance application form examples

Create Binary Search Tree(BST) using Inorder And Preorder in …

Category:Coding-ninja-dsa/construct-tree-from-preorder-and-inorder.cpp ... - Github

Tags:Binary tree using preorder and inorder

Binary tree using preorder and inorder

Construct a binary tree from inorder and preorder traversal

WebFeb 15, 2024 · Trees are one of the most fundamental data structures for storing data.A binary tree is defined as a data structure organized in a binary way, where each node has at most two children typically ... WebOct 23, 2015 · def build_tree (inorder, preorder): head = preorder [0] head_pos = inorder.index (head) left_in = inorder [:head_pos] right_in = inorder [ (head_pos+1):] left_pre = preorder [1:-len (right_in)] right_pre = preorder [-len (right_in):] if left_in: left_tree = build_tree (left_in, left_pre) else: left_tree = None if right_in: right_tree = build_tree …

Binary tree using preorder and inorder

Did you know?

WebMar 16, 2024 · First, let’s do some discussion about the traversal of binary tree. 1. Pre-order Traversal [ NLR ] First, visit the node then the left side, and then the right side. WebAug 2,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and …

WebFirst, visit all the nodes in the left subtree Then the root node Visit all the nodes in the right subtree inorder(root->left) display(root->data) inorder(root->right) Preorder traversal Visit root node Visit all the nodes … WebFor a given postorder and inorder traversal of a Binary Tree of type integer stored in an array/list, create the binary tree using the given two arrays/lists. You just need to construct the tree and return the root. Note: Assume that the Binary Tree contains only unique elements. Input Format:

WebTo find the boundary, search for the index of the root node in the inorder sequence. All keys before the root node in the inorder sequence become part of the left subtree, and all keys after the root node become part of the right subtree. Repeat this recursively for all nodes in the tree and construct the tree in the process. WebJun 16, 2024 · How to traverse a tree using JavaScript by Purnima Gupta Level Up Coding 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Purnima Gupta 53 Followers More from Medium FullStackTips 20 Javascript interview questions with code answers. …

WebFor traversing a (non-empty) binary tree in a preorder fashion, we must do these three things for every node n starting from the tree’s root: (N) Process n itself. (L) Recursively traverse its left subtree. When this step is finished, we are back at n again. (R) Recursively traverse its right subtree.

WebConstruct a full binary tree from a preorder and postorder sequence A full binary tree is a tree in which every node has either 0 or 2 children. Write an efficient algorithm to construct a full binary tree from a given preorder and postorder sequence. For example, Input: Preorder traversal : { 1, 2, 4, 5, 3, 6, 8, 9, 7 } earl nightingale conantWebThe next important type under the binary tree is called a complete binary tree. (Also Read: Python Tutorial on Partition and QuickSort Algorithm) Complete Binary Tree . Complete … css in tablesWebJun 23, 2024 · 1 Probably you can add to a set that tracks already seen indices in case of duplicate values. – SomeDude Jun 23, 2024 at 22:51 3 If all the values are the same, then the inorder and preorder traversals are the same no matter what the shape of the tree is, so the shape cannot be reconstructed. – Matt Timmermans Jun 24, 2024 at 2:49 earl nightingale direct line pdfWebJan 26, 2024 · In this tutorial, we will use the Inorder, Preorder, and Post order tree traversal methods. The major importance of tree traversal is that there are multiple ways … earl nightingale essence of successWebApr 2, 2024 · We are given 2 sequences of size N, i.e., the number of nodes in the binary tree. The first sequence is the pre-order traversal of the binary tree and the second sequence is the in-order traversal of the binary tree. Your task is to construct a Binary Tree from a given Preorder and Inorder traversal. css interbankingearl nightingale free mp3 downloadsWebWe can construct a unique binary tree from inorder and preorder sequences and the inorder and postorder sequences. But preorder and postorder sequences don’t provide … earl nightingale collection